The Notch Signaling Pathway and Breast Cancer: The Importance of Balance and Cellular Self-Control
Background: Notch is a cell signaling pathway that is highly conserved in all metazoans and is the master responsible for cell differentiation and cross communication with other signaling pathways such as Wingless and Hedgehog.
